    I have been testing your form and I can see the emails are not sending. Please double check your SMTP credentials since this may be why your emails do note send. 

    If after confirming the SMTP settings are correct you're still not able to receive emails, please let us know. 

    Also, I noticed you're using the "Uploads as attachments" option enabled, this option will not work if you're using an SMTP sender, if you want such option you will need to use the default ones noreply@jotform.com or noreply@formresponse.com
